Output 87a0d057f24d65f09a3899f35a1516fc0c306234ca24b31f111f73363b64df78:0

value
65690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02184df462c3e25fd794c79d4a9ecebbe83da9e OP_EQUAL
address
3LfWdPSJ4iFmW1Jp92D7uwMRCgeYa2kz7G
transaction
87a0d057f24d65f09a3899f35a1516fc0c306234ca24b31f111f73363b64df78
confirmations
125042
spent
true